Course summary

Driven by tech innovation and rise of digital media, the PR market is forecast to reach £103.04 billion ($133.82 billion) by 2027 (Bluetree Digital, July 2025). Our online MSc in Public Relations and Strategic Communications puts you at the heart of this dynamic, fast-growing industry. Develop PR, strategic communication and digital skills This online Masters in PR and Strategic Communication is a flexible way to fully understand modern public relations. You’ll: cover core topics like public relations and communications theories, strategic PR planning, media relations and production, and research methods design and evaluate a strategic public relations plan have the opportunity to work with PR practitioners on real-life cases gain an applied understanding of quantitative and qualitative research methods for media and audience research attend and present your work online at the annual Postgraduate Public Relations Conference focus on how digital media is used in communication campaigns. Professional accreditation and recognition The course is recognised by the Chartered Institute of Public Relations. CIPR is Europe’s largest and globally influential professional body for public relations. We're also members of the European Public Relations Education and Research Association (EUPRERA) and European Communication Research and Education Association (ECREA). These memberships provide valuable resources, networking opportunities, and professional development to help you advance in your career and contribute to the field. Flexible learning with optional field experiences While most learning happens online, you can supplement your studies with optional field trips to: Brussels for public affairs seminars at the European institutions. Scottish Parliament in Edinburgh. A residential week including lectures and seminars at Stirling. These trips are optional and designed to accommodate distance learners. Research placements As an online student, you can choose our strategic communications research placement module. This gives you hands-on research experience working remotely with non-academic organisations on research projects. Previous projects include: How racial justice documentaries can be used as a public relations tool The role of public relations and media in legitimising accounts of sexual violation Building the Nation: Analysing the Scottish Government’s Public Diplomacy Campaign Scotland is Now in the Context of Brexit How you study online This flexible Masters degree in PR and Communications is delivered virtually. We use Microsoft Teams and our virtual learning environment Canvas for classes. You will have access to interactive content, discussion forums, and virtual workshops. Award-winning students Our online Masters in PR and strategic communication students have been nominated and won EUPRERA Thesis Awards in 2019, 2021, 2022 and 2023. Comprehensive employability and skills programme Our employability and skills programme to helps you to develop the attributes that employers look for. The University of Stirling’s Careers Service works in partnership with academic staff to ensure you are ready for the employment market. The course includes three compulsory modules, three optional modules and a dissertation.
